A Portuguese-Hawai'i Kitchen: The Local Foods of Island Portuguese explores Hawai'i's Portuguese cooking starting with the familiar soups and breads, on to basic traditional dishes and special festive recipes. The collection incorporates the initial simple resourceful diet of major proteins and greens grown in backyard gardens and the adaptation to locally available ingredients as the Portuguese adjusted to island life.
Third-generation food writer and historian, Wanda Adams, has gathered from family, neighbors, and friends these treasured, handed-down recipes that revive those sprawling kitchen tables ringed by large, loving families.
